Resource: Florida Center for Students with Unique Abilities – UCF

Services/Products Provided:

The Florida Center for Students with Unique Abilities at the University of Central Florida supports the development of inclusive higher education programs for students with intellectual disabilities, known as Florida Postsecondary Comprehensive Transition Programs (FPCTPs) at universities, state colleges, technical colleges, and accredited not for profit institutions of higher education in Florida. The Center also provides FPCTP Student Scholarships as well as resources to students and families in the pursuit of postsecondary education.
